This place is amazing. A food hall but you are seated in an elegant dining room and order food from various "stalls" online and it's brought to your table. The options include Mexican Nepali Indonesian Indian and Japanese. There is also an American option. The food was mostly small plates and ideal for sharing. Everything we ate was superb from the pork taco to the paneer. And there's a good cocktail beer and wine selection. Prices extremely reasonable. Service was five star. Attentive and helpful. This is the first time I've been to a five star food hall and you won't see anything like this routinely so if in London you must try. And location extremely central right by the Tottenham Court Rd tube. Oh and ignore the reviews that say the portions are too small. THEY ARE SMALL PLATES. Yes, you have to order several plates to make a meal. Have these people never been to a tapas restaurant?? Prices are reasonable despite some of the reviews especially for the quality of the food. I ate and drank till I couldn't breathe for 45 quid and that included a delicious margarita. I ordered Nepali Indonesian and Indian plates. Couldn't even eat it all. So prices are indeed reasonable and yes small plates are SMALL!! If you only order one small plate you will be disappointed.

Arcade is essentially an upscale food hall where instead of queuing for food you have table service with a selection of different food vendors from around the world. We opted for the 'All In' package when we visited whereby you get bottomless food for 90mins from a selected menu. It was a good option if you want to sample a bit of everything! A great experience, perhaps not the most authentic tasting dishes in some instances, but still a good option for international cuisines in the heart of Central London!

Great concept of one location hosting I think 9 different kitchens under one house. Most vendors are halal and you can order from your table by scanning the QR code and the menu clearly labels what is halal. The staff are very helpful and attentive. The lady who welcomed me in explained what is halal and which places may have potential cross contamination which was very helpful. I tried the Hot Smash Burger from Manna and have to say it's one of the best smash burgers London has to offer. There was a bit of confusion with one of my orders but the manager Azam was brilliant in resolving the issue and full credit for his customer service. I'll definitely be back to see what else is on offer and it's a brilliant location just outside Tottenham Court Road tube station.
